-3

我是java的初学者,我想知道LinkedList这里是如何使用的。

public LinkedList<nameofclass> getsomething(String a, int L)

这是代码:

public LinkedList<Save> getBrightness( 
    String params, 
    Integer colors, 
    Integer[] BrightnessValue, 
    boolean clear) 
{ 
    ...
    LinkedList<Save> equal = new LinkedList<Save>(); 

Save 是一个位于外部的类我不明白这段代码

4

1 回答 1

0

该方法getBrightness正在创建一个LinkedList包含 class 实例的实例Save。大概稍后在代码中你会发现一个包含

Save s = new Save(...);
s.set...(...);  // maybe
...
equal.add(s);

这将创建多个实例Save并将它们添加到列表中。最后将是

return equal;

链表被用作容器,以便getBrightness可以返回多个值。

于 2012-10-05T17:24:30.183 回答